What is the Colonoscopy Consent Form?
The Colonoscopy Consent Form is a critical medical consent document designed to secure patient agreement for undergoing a colonoscopy. Its primary purpose is to inform patients about the procedure, including essential details such as purpose, risks, and alternatives. This medical consent form contains multiple components that outline what patients can expect throughout their experience.
Key elements of the Colonoscopy Consent Form include comprehensive descriptions of the procedure's steps, the associated risks, and possible alternative treatments, ensuring patients are well-informed before consenting to this vital procedure.

Who Needs the Colonoscopy Consent Form?
The Colonoscopy Consent Form is necessary for all patients scheduled for a colonoscopy, particularly those undergoing biopsies, polypectomies, or treatments for hemorrhoids and bleeding. This authorization form helps designate eligibility criteria, ensuring that patients have the opportunity to ask questions and consider their options prior to the procedure.
Physicians hold the responsibility of securing consent, emphasizing the importance of patient understanding and agreement before proceeding with the colonoscopy.

Who needs to sign the Colonoscopy Consent Form?
The Colonoscopy Consent Form requires signatures from both the patient or authorized agent and the physician performing the procedure. This ensures that all parties are informed and in agreement with the procedure details.
Is there a deadline for submitting the Colonoscopy Consent Form?
While specific deadlines may vary by healthcare provider, it is generally advisable to complete and submit the Colonoscopy Consent Form at least 24 hours prior to the scheduled procedure to allow for processing.
What information do I need to complete this form?
You will need to provide personal details such as your name, date of birth, contact information, as well as any medical history relevant to the procedure, including current medications and previous surgeries.

What happens if I forget to sign the Colonoscopy Consent Form?
Failing to sign the Colonoscopy Consent Form may delay your procedure. It’s essential that both the patient and physician sign the form to ensure legality and acceptance of consent for the procedure.
Are there any fees associated with processing the Colonoscopy Consent Form?
The Colonoscopy Consent Form itself usually does not incur fees; however, fees for the colonoscopy procedure or consultation may apply. Always check with your healthcare provider for any associated costs.
What if I have questions about the Colonoscopy procedure while filling out the consent form?
It’s important to ask your healthcare provider any questions or concerns about the colonoscopy procedure before signing the consent form. They can provide the necessary information to ensure you understand the risks and benefits involved.
